Golabatun is a kind of traditional embriodery, in which most part of fabric is covered by different motives by a yarn. In the past the yarn was from gold
The manufacturers of this product are mostly girls and women, and this sewing is predominantly used in the Persian Gulf and cities in Place not specified province and some western cities of the Place not specified province. The main use of this stitching is on the traditional clothes of the people of this area, and especially on pants called portraits, but this sewing is still used to decorate other types of clothing and home appliances.
